We review a very serious call with genuine and dire airway concerns in today's episode. The sound is going to be a bit wonky (Yes we know and Yes we did fix it for the future) but we review multiple airway procedures and techniques to help you gain better success in both the BLS and ALS airway interventions. We are joined with Mike (NYS EMT, NYS CIC), Kelsey (NYS EMT), Gerard (NYS AEMT-P) and Emily (NYS EMT-B / ER RN).
